Introduction

Counting scales are essential tools for businesses that require accurate counting of items. These scales function by weighing a sample quantity of items and then calculating the total count based on the weight of the sample. This process not only saves time but also enhances accuracy in inventory management.

When considering counting scales, it's important to look for features that cater to your specific needs. Here are some key aspects to consider:
  • Capacity: Ensure the scale can handle the weight of your items.
  • Precision: Choose a scale that provides accurate readings to avoid discrepancies.
  • Ease of Use: Look for user-friendly interfaces that simplify the counting process.
  • Durability: Select a scale made from quality materials for long-lasting performance.

FAQs

How can I choose the best counting scale for my needs?

Consider factors such as capacity, precision, ease of use, and durability when selecting a counting scale.

What are the key features to look for when selecting counting scales?

Look for features like weight capacity, display readability, battery life, and additional functionalities like tare and unit conversion.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ing counting scales?

Common mistakes include not considering the weight capacity needed, overlooking precision requirements, and failing to check for user-friendly features.

Can counting scales be used for different types of items?

Yes, counting scales can be used for a variety of items, from small parts to larger products, as long as they are within the scale's weight capacity.

How do I maintain my counting scale for long-lasting performance?

Regularly clean the scale, calibrate it as needed, and ensure it is stored properly to maintain its accuracy and longevity.
